mysql的varchar都可以插入那些数据
时间: 2024-04-21 22:27:49 浏览: 210
MySQL的VARCHAR数据类型可以用于存储任何字符串类型的数据,包括纯文本、数字、日期和时间等。VARCHAR类型的字段可以存储最大长度为65535个字符的数据,但是实际上,由于MySQL的限制,VARCHAR类型的字段最大长度通常为65532个字符。VARCHAR类型的字段和CHAR类型的字段不同,它们的长度是可变的,VARCHAR字段只会占用必要的存储空间,而CHAR类型的字段则会占用固定的存储空间。因此,VARCHAR类型的字段通常比CHAR类型的字段更节省存储空间。
相关问题
mysql的varchar和java里什么数据类型对应
在 MySQL 数据库中,VARCHAR 数据类型用于存储可变长度的字符数据。它可以存储最大长度为 65,535 字节的字符串。
在 Java 中,可以使用 String 类型来对应 MySQL 的 VARCHAR 数据类型。 Java 中的 String 类型可以表示任意长度的字符串。当从数据库中检索 VARCHAR 类型的数据时,Java 会将其作为 String 类型处理。同样,当将字符串插入到 VARCHAR 列中时,可以使用 Java 的 String 类型作为参数。
例如,在使用 JDBC 连接 MySQL 数据库时,可以使用 Java 的 String 类型来处理 VARCHAR 列的数据。
mysql 中varchar
varchar是一种MySQL中的数据类型,它用于存储可变长度的字符数据,也就是字符串。varchar可以存储任何长度的字符串,但是它有一个最大长度限制,取决于定义时指定的长度。当插入数据时,MySQL会自动根据实际数据长度来分配存储空间,因此,使用varchar比使用固定长度的字符类型如char更节省空间。同时,varchar也支持索引和比较操作。它常用于存储文本、邮件、用户名、密码等字符数据。
阅读全文